High School/Local College Sports Roundup for Sept. 21, 2012

Updated: September 22, 2012 8:28PM



Football

Sandwich 14, No. 7 Coal City 10: Nate Natyshok had a 5-yard touchdown run for visiting Coal City (4-1, 2-1) in the Interstate Eight Large. Ryland Tondini led the Coalers in rushing with 78 yards on 13 attempts.

No. 8 Wilmington 31, Seneca 0: Alex Zlomie’s 45-yard interception return for a touchdown sparked visiting Wilmington (4-1, 3-0) in the Interstate Eight Small. Seneca dropped to 2-3, 2-1.

Manteno 17, Peotone 14: Jace Cowger (4 yards) and Danny Beresky (35) provided touchdown runs for visiting Peotone (3-1, 1-1) in the Interstate Eight Large.

Westmont 35, Reed-Custer 14: Cameron Novak scored both touchdowns for visiting Reed-Custer (1-4, 1-2) in the Interstate Eight Small.

Lisle 40, Dwight 0: Cliff Krause ran for 116 yards and three touchdowns to spark visiting Lisle (3-2, 2-1) in the Interstate Eight Small. Dwight fell to 0-5, 0-3.

Boys Golf

Don Nichols Invitational: Medalist Gehrig Hollatz shot a 71 in helping Lockport (307) gain a share of the title with Neuqua Valley at Wedgewood. Trent Wallace (72), of Joliet Township co-op, was second, followed by Lincoln-Way Central’s Tony Kestel (73) and Lemont’s Matt Groebe (74). Lincoln-Way Central (308) was third in the team standings, followed by Lincoln-Way East (317) and Joliet Township co-op (323).

Girls Golf

Minooka 193, Joliet Township co-op 203: Medalist Gabby Osorio shot a 43 in leading Minooka at Inwood. Milena Singletary (46) had the top score for Joliet Township co-op.

Women’s Volleyball

Lewis 18-25-25-25, St. Francis 25-18-16-18: Colleen Mitros and Cassidy Parsons pounded 13 kills apiece for host Lewis (6-6). Jazzmyne Robbins led St. Francis (13-3) with 14 kills.
